The dangers of long-term chewing of coffee beans: Be careful!

Coffee is a popular beverage that many people drink several cups a day. However, some people choose to chew the beans directly, a habit that may pose some potential health risks.

First, long-term chewing of coffee beans may cause damage to teeth. Since coffee beans are hard and sticky, frequently chewing them in the mouth will increase the friction between the tooth surface and the substance. This can easily lead to oral problems such as tooth enamel wear, tooth decay, and periodontitis.



Secondly, there are choking and digestion issues when swallowing whole or partially ground coffee beans without processing for a long time. Whole or partially ground coffee beans may be too large to pass smoothly through the esophagus into the stomach and easily cause choking incidents. In addition, swallowing coffee beans of similar size but harder and more resistant to digestion in raw capsule form (such as vitamin capsules) before being fully roasted and processed may also cause indigestion, stomach pain and intestinal blockage.

In addition, long-term chewing of coffee beans may also have a negative impact on the digestive system. Caffeine is a stimulant, and excessive intake will increase gastric acid secretion and stimulate intestinal peristalsis. This may lead to problems such as acid reflux, ulcers, and gastrointestinal discomfort. In addition, since a lot of air is swallowed during chewing, it is easy to cause digestive discomfort symptoms such as bloating and burping.

Finally, when consuming large amounts of unprocessed coffee beans over a long period of time, it is also necessary to consider the effects on other organs in the body. For example, high concentrations of caffeine intake may increase heart rate, blood pressure, and nervous system excitability, and have been linked to problems such as insomnia, anxiety, and dizziness.

In summary, in daily life, you should try to avoid habitually or frequently swallowing unprocessed whole or partially ground coffee beans. If you like to enjoy the pure flavor of coffee, it is recommended to choose to drink roasted and processed coffee in moderation to reduce potential health risks.
